Transaction 3e1bccc61959de2fe7d6f7cd849688756bddbe21e2a28c1de2677c2728763a33

1 Input
2 Outputs
  • 3e1bccc61959de2fe7d6f7cd849688756bddbe21e2a28c1de2677c2728763a33:0
  • value  260633587
    address  1Pv37doee18BR49SE8BpusEPsAVLBssbUA
  • 3e1bccc61959de2fe7d6f7cd849688756bddbe21e2a28c1de2677c2728763a33:1
  • value  51762586
    address  16AXpCZzNihXYj1sVfyqeqzB3TZV3pkL3w